Bossaball: Soccer Volleyball on Trampolines

By: Bob | March 26th, 2007

As far as alternative soccer sports go Bossaball looks much more fun than playing with fire or on motorcycles. Combining the skills of capoeira, samba, breakdance, football, volleyball, acrobatics and circus on those really cool inflatable playgrounds you have at your 5th birthday party, the sport is gaining popularity on the beaches of Brazil. Played with teams of 3,4, or 5 players, a critical element of Bossaball is the Samba Referees. Just be forewarned that you can be given a penalty if you disagree with his choice of music.
